Two-hour school bus delays because of thick fog are about to become a thing of the past in the London region.
As of September, Southwestern Ontario Student Transportation Services will eliminate the two-hour fog delay. In the event of foggy conditions, morning bus service will now be cancelled entirely. Unless otherwise notified, buses would return to their normal schedule in the afternoon, picking up students who made it to school despite the weather conditions.
Any cancellations due to inclement weather will be posted online by 6:30am on www.mybigyellowbus.ca.
The transportation association represents those in the Thames Valley District School Board and the London District Catholic School Board.
The policy change was announced Monday.
